Summary

  • CRA / supply chain (pillar + offering scope): Expand security-sovereignty-compliance.md with CRA due diligence, CVE noise, EU manufacturer use cases, and compliance-driven private-fork context. Add private-fork labor cost to cost-optimization.md where fork maintenance is the buyer problem. Extend Expert Support with CVE overload and triage-at-scale scenarios (Linux Foundation CRA readiness report).
  • Agentic AI (data-layer scope): Update future-readiness-ai.md with McKinsey April 2026 stats and governed-retrieval positioning; light alignment in PostgreSQL and PMM messaging. Scope boundary unchanged: database performance, security, and vector retrieval, not agent orchestration or LLM design.
  • Framework: No change to why-percona.md. Private-fork and CVE stewardship stay in pillars and offerings where the situation is specific, not at company-level positioning.

Why we're doing this

Enterprise buyers are moving from GenAI pilots toward agentic workflows, but scaling is stalling on data foundations, not models. McKinsey reports that most organizations experimenting with agents have not scaled them, with data limitations cited as the primary blocker. That reinforces Percona's existing future-readiness thesis: AI value depends on governed, portable database infrastructure teams already operate, not proprietary AI SKUs or parallel ungoverned data silos.

In parallel, EU Cyber Resilience Act pressure and rising CVE noise are pushing manufacturers toward active due diligence on open source dependencies, including databases. That work belongs in security, cost, and Expert Support messaging where the buyer situation is specific, not in top-level company positioning.

Primary impact

Future readiness positioning is the main audience for this change. The McKinsey-backed agentic AI context, governed-retrieval use case, and light PostgreSQL/PMM alignment give field and web teams current buyer language and proof points for why dependable database estates matter as autonomy increases.

CRA and CVE additions are secondary: they support compliance and supply-chain conversations in the security pillar and Expert Support offering without shifting core company framing in why-percona.md.

- **US extraterritorial access risk:** Teams that cannot rely on US hyperscaler control planes need hosting they choose, including non-US infrastructure, because US law can compel technology companies to hand over stored data regardless of server location. Percona does not host customer data; customers run the stack on infrastructure that matches their jurisdictional requirements.
- **Multi-tenant platform isolation:** Shared platforms must separate tenants or business units without control-policy drift. Percona Operators support Kubernetes namespaces, network policies, and RBAC so isolation stays consistent across MySQL, PostgreSQL, and MongoDB-compatible workloads.
- **EU software supply chain compliance:** Teams shipping products with digital elements into the EU must determine whether they are manufacturers under the Cyber Resilience Act and exercise due diligence on open source dependencies, including databases. Private forks add audit burden and recurring integration labor; passive reliance on upstream security fixes does not meet active vulnerability-management expectations. Percona develops and sustains supported database software with public CVE handling and documented lifecycles. Customers remain responsible for their product as manufacturer; Percona helps on the database tier with inspectable software, PMM security findings, and Expert Support for prioritized remediation. Percona does not certify full product CRA compliance.
- **Compliance-driven private forks:** Some teams maintain private forks of database components as a short-term compliance workaround. Industry research estimates roughly $258,000 in labor per release cycle to maintain private open source forks at scale ([Linux Foundation 2026 CRA Awareness and Readiness Report](https://www.linuxfoundation.org/research/cra-readiness-2026)). Supported engagement with sustained upstream distributions reduces divergent codebase debt and strengthens the supply chain evidence manufacturers need.
